Young Manchester United Star Joins Cristiano Ronaldo In Signing For Jorge Mendes Agency

Young Manchester United starlet, Shola Shoretire, has joined Jorge Mendes’ agency.

Portuguese super agent, Jorge Mendes, has added young Manchester United star Shola Shoretire to his ranks of clients at his agency.

Shoretire has been developing his reputation at Manchester United over the past couple of years, with the winger touted for a stellar career ahead of him.

Mendes himself is already well established in the world of football, with his agency, Polaris Sport, having high-profile clients such as Cristiano Ronaldo, David de Gea and Bernardo Silva.

It was reported by George Smith of the Manchester Evening News that Shoretire has signed with the Lisbon based agency, becoming one of a number of United players represented by Polaris Sport.

The 18-year-old uploaded a picture of himself and Mendes to his Instagram to confirm his signing with the agency.

The England U19 will be hoping that signing with such a notable agency will kick start his career, after coming through the youth ranks at Old Trafford.

Shoretire made his only Premier League appearance of the season in the final game, coming off the bench for eight minutes in a 1-0 defeat to Crystal Palace.

Prior to this, Shoretire had made four other appearances for the senior team, with a single appearance in both the Champions League and Europa League, as well as two in the Premier League in the 20/21 season.

Despite limited senior playing time, Shoretire’s remarkable performances in the PL2 for United’s U23 side have developed his reputation both at the club and in the wider footballing world.

He recorded six goals and 8 assists in 21 appearances during the 21/22 season, with this accounting for 31% of United’s goals in the competition.

With the Red already having Jadon Sancho, Anthony Elanga and Amad Diallo in the right wing position, it is unlikely that Shoretire will find himself as a consistent feature in the senior side next season.

This will become even more unlikely if United bring Antony to Old Trafford, with reports of a deal between United and Ajax being close growing.

It is likely therefore that the winger’s new representation will push for a loan move in order to develop his reputation in the game and get the player valuable minutes in senior football.

While there has been little speculation as to where Shoretire could spend time on loan, he could follow in the footsteps of Amad and seek playing time in the Scottish Premiership.

Alternatively, he could develop his trade in the championship, with the championship being the most common loan move for Premier league youngsters. James Garner found success here whilst on loan at Nottingham Forest from United in the 21/22 season, with Forest getting promoted to the Premier League through the play offs under Steve Cooper.

Whilst Shoretire’s future for next season is currently unclear, new representation for Jorge Mendes will certainly help the winger to fulfill his desires, should that be at United or a loan move away from the club.

Shoretire will have time to impress Erik ten Hag during the few weeks ahead of Manchester United’s first pre-season fixture against Liverpool in Bangkok.

Throughout the tour which sees the club visit Thailand, Australia and Norway, Ten Hag shall be assessing his initial thoughts on both the club’s current crop as well as those waiting in the ranks of the U18s and U23s.
